Content cover
The Statement Poster

The Statement

2022 6 • 15 min

The Statement

2022 6/10 15 min

After investigating an Elder cult's meeting place, a professor wakes to find himself in an interrogation room with a grotesquely scarred hand.

Released
May 19, 2022
Country

By browsing this website, you accept our cookies policy.